System Access Fund Project Agreement Page 1 of 29 <br /> GA 0162-22 <br />SYSTEM ACCESS FUND PROJECT AGREEMENT <br />BETWEEN CITY OF EVERETT AND THE CENTRAL PUGET SOUND <br />REGIONAL TRANSIT AUTHORITY FOR <br />EVERETT STATION NON-MOTORIZED ACCESS IMPROVEMENTS <br />GA 0162-22 <br />This Agreement, made and entered into on _________________, between the City of Everett <br />(hereinafter “City”), and the Central Puget Sound Regional Transit Authority, (hereinafter "Sound <br />Transit"); <br />WHEREAS, the Sound Transit 3 (“ST3”) high capacity transit system expansion plan was <br />approved by the voters in November 2016 and includes a $100 million System Access Program to <br />“fund such projects as safe sidewalks and protected bike lanes, shared use paths, improved bus- <br />rail integration, and new pick-up and drop-off areas that provide convenient access so that more <br />people can use Sound Transit services;” <br />WHEREAS, Sound Transit opened the System Access Fund 2019 Call for Projects in February <br />2019 and subsequently evaluated applications from local governments against evaluation criteria <br />identified by the Sound Transit Executive Committee; <br />WHEREAS, at the conclusion of the public comment period and online open house in August <br />2019, the Sound Transit Board of Directors approved 30 applications from 27 local governments <br />on September 26, 2019; <br />WHEREAS, Sound Transit and the City have a joint interest in delivering on non-motorized access <br />improvements at the corner of the Angel of the Winds Arena, (hereinafter the “Project”), which <br />was duly approved by the Sound Transit Board as part of the System Access Program by virtue of <br />M2019-97; <br />NOW THEREFORE, in consideration of the terms, conditions, covenants, and performances <br />contained herein, or attached and incorporated and made a part hereof, it is mutually agreed as <br />follows: <br />1.GENERAL <br />1.1. Purpose. The intent of this Agreement is to establish the terms and conditions for the eligible <br />work to be performed for the Project during the duration of this Agreement. Attached hereto <br />as Exhibit A, is the Scope of Work and Deliverables, which outlines the activities, products <br />and general capital improvements eligible for funding by Sound Transit, as presented to Sound <br />Transit in the City’s application for Project funding. Funds may be expended on eligible <br />elements listed in Exhibit A up to the not to exceed amount outlined in Section 1.2 below. <br />07/20/2023
